V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. – The Monroe College – Bronx men's basketball team (7-6) will compete in three consecutive games this weekend in the state of Virginia. The Express will complete the second half of their home-and-home series against Bryant & Stratton College Va. (JV) (2-3) on Friday, December 15, at Atlantic Shore Christian Gymnasium at 7:00 p.m. The next day, they will battle Virginia Peninsula Community College (4-4) at Warwick Gymnasium at 3:00 p.m. On Sunday, December 17, Monroe – Bronx will close out its three-game Virginia road trip with a matchup at Paul D. Camp Community College (5-3), at Paul D. Camp CC Gymnasium, starting at 2:00 p.m.

"We are looking forward to really competitive games which will get us prepared for the second half of Region 15 play," Express Head Coach
Chris Neely said. "We also get to spend more time with each other off the court."
This will be Monroe's first ever meeting against Paul D. Camp. Monroe fell to Virginia Peninsula, 73-60, in Virginia last season on December 18, 2022. The Express knocked off Bryant & Stratton Va. (JV), 79-64, this past Sunday, December 10, at Monroe Athetic Complex.
In Monroe's victory over the Bobcats, sophomore forward
Abubakar Kromah had a strong game for the Express with a game-high 26 points, led all players with 14 rebounds, and dished out four assists. Freshman guard
Steven McGriff also had a double-double with 14 points and 12 boards, while dishing out a trio of assists coming off the bench.
For Bryant & Stratton, freshman guard Tyler Lindsay scored 22 points, grabbed six rebounds, and dished out four assists against the Express.
ABOUT THE ATHLETIC PROGRAM AT MONROE COLLEGE
The athletic program at Monroe College encompasses a total of 31 teams competing across nine sports. There are 21 varsity and junior varsity programs, as well as club men's and women's rugby, the Monroe College marching band, and the newly added esports and men's volleyball programs, competing on the New Rochelle campus as the Mustangs (NJCAA Division I). The Monroe Express, based out of the Bronx campus, has seven teams competing at the NJCAA Division III level.
